                                                                                                                                  The Method
                                                                                                                                  Bring 1 inch of water to a
                                                                                                                                boil in a large saucepan fitted
                                                                                                                                with a steamer basket. Place
                                                                                                                                large eggs in the basket (no
                                                                                                                                more than will cover the
                                                                                                                                bottom). Cover; cook 12
                                                                                                                                minutes. Transfer to a bowl of
                                                                                                                                ice water to cool. Drain, crack
                                                                                                                                and peel.
                                                                                                                                  The Results
                                                                                                                                  According to the American
                                                                                                                                Egg Board, the pressure
                                                                                                                                created by the steam forces the
                                                                                                                                membrane to separate from
                                                                                                                                the egg, making it easy to
                                                                                                                                peel. As promised, the shell
                                                                                                                                slipped right off.
